What Is Soft Washing?
At its core, soft washing is a low-pressure cleaning method that combines water with eco-friendly cleaning solutions designed to kill organic growth such as:
- Algae
- Mold and mildew
- Moss and fungi
- Bacteria and biofilm
Instead of blasting surfaces with water pressure (which can cause cracks or paint chipping), soft washing gently cleans surfaces and sanitizes them at the microbial level.
The Science Behind Soft Wash Cleaning
Soft washing is based on microbiological science. Here’s how it works step by step:
1. Understanding the Problem: Organic Growth
The stains on roofs, siding, and driveways aren’t just dirt. In Atlanta, most of the discoloration comes from Gloeocapsa magma, a bacteria that thrives in warm, humid environments. Left untreated, it spreads quickly and damages materials like asphalt shingles, wood, and paint.
2. Biodegradable Cleaning Solutions
Soft washing uses specialized detergents made from surfactants and biodegradable biocides. These solutions break down organic buildup at the root, killing bacteria, algae, and mold instead of just removing their visible layer.
- Surfactants loosen dirt and grime from surfaces.
- Biocides kill living microorganisms such as algae and bacteria.
- Rinsing agents ensure residues are safely washed away.
3. Low-Pressure Application
The cleaning solution is applied with equipment that sprays water at less than 500 PSI (compared to pressure washing which uses 2,000–4,000 PSI). This prevents surface damage while allowing the cleaning agents to work effectively.
4. Chemical Reaction and Sanitization
The solution reacts with organic growth, breaking down cell walls and neutralizing spores. This eliminates the source of discoloration rather than just masking it.
5. Long-Term Protection
Since soft washing kills the microorganisms, regrowth takes much longer. Surfaces stay cleaner for up to 4–6 times longer compared to traditional pressure washing.
Why Soft Washing Lasts Longer Than Pressure Washing
The durability of soft washing results comes down to elimination versus displacement.
- Pressure Washing: Removes visible dirt and algae, but leaves spores behind. These spores quickly regrow, often within months.
- Soft Washing: Destroys the spores and root systems of algae and mold. This provides long-lasting results that can last up to 3–5 years depending on conditions.

The Atlanta Climate Factor: Why Soft Washing is Ideal Here
Atlanta’s subtropical climate with high humidity and frequent rainfall makes it a breeding ground for organic growth. Roofs, siding, and even brick walls often develop dark streaks and green algae.
Soft washing is particularly effective in this environment because:
- It targets moisture-loving organisms directly.
- It prevents rapid regrowth in damp weather.
- It protects surfaces from accelerated weathering caused by heat and humidity.

How Often Should You Soft Wash in Atlanta?
The frequency of soft washing depends on the surface and surrounding conditions, but in Atlanta’s climate, most homeowners benefit from:
- Roofs: Every 2–3 years
- Siding: Every 1–2 years
- Driveways/Sidewalks: Annually
- Decks/Fences: Annually or biannually depending on exposure
By following this schedule, surfaces remain clean, attractive, and damage-free.
